Mr. Georges Nicolas Hayek, Jr., serves as Chairman of the Executive Group Management Board, Chief Executive Officer, Member of the Board of Directors at The Swatch Group Ltd since May 12, 2010. He pursued two years study at the University of St. Gallen, then attended the Film Academy CLCF in Paris. President of the Executive Group Management Board since 2003 and member of the Board of Directors since 2010. Mr Hayek has worked with the Swatch Group since 1992, firstly as Swatch Ltd Marketing Manager, then as Swatch Ltd President and finally as Delegate of the Board of Directors of Swatch Ltd. In the mideighties, he founded his own production company, Sesame Films in Paris, and worked in Switzerland and abroad. His involvement in a number of film productions, then the production of a number of short films and his activity as producer and manager of two feature films, Das Land von Wilhelm Tell and Family Express with Peter Fonda resulted in his being called upon to advise on various Swatch projects in the early 90s and to assume responsibility for several Swatch exhibitions . Mr Hayek is a member of the Board of Directors of the CSEM and Chairman of the Board of Directors of Belenos Clean Power Holding Ltd. since 2010.

Elected by the shareholders, the Swatch Group's board of directors comprises two types of representatives: Swatch Group inside directors who are chosen from within the company, and outside directors, selected externally and held independent of Swatch. The board's role is to monitor Swatch Group's management team and ensure that shareholders' interests are well served. Swatch Group's inside directors are responsible for reviewing and approving budgets prepared by upper management to implement core corporate initiatives and projects. On the other hand, Swatch Group's outside directors are responsible for providing unbiased perspectives on the board's policies.
